Lemon Herbed Chicken

Prep: 10 min Cook: 50 min Serves: 10 Cuisine: American

Juicy lemon herbed chicken pieces infused with garlic and herbs, baked to perfection — a flavorful, easy-to-make dish perfect for family dinners or entertaining guests.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 10 pieces chicken
  • 1/4 cup oil
  • 1/3 cup lemon juice
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1 teaspoon Season-All
  • 1 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 teaspoon lemon herb seasoning

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, combine lemon juice, oil, garlic, Season-All, pepper, and lemon herb seasoning.
  3. Arrange chicken pieces in a shallow casserole dish.
  4. Pour the lemon and oil mixture over the chicken.
  5. Cover the dish and bake until tender, about 40 minutes, basting occasionally.
  6. Uncover and bake for an additional 10 minutes to brown the chicken.
  7. Sprinkle with chopped parsley before serving.

Tips & Substitutions

For added flavor, marinate the chicken in the lemon and herb mixture for a few hours or overnight. If you don't have lemon herb seasoning, a mix of dried thyme and rosemary can be a great substitute. Storage & Reheating

Store any leftover Lemon Herbed Chicken in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, place the chicken in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 15-20 minutes, or until heated through. You can also microwave it, but be cautious not to dry it out.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use boneless chicken for this recipe?

Yes, boneless chicken can be used in this recipe. Just reduce the cooking time to about 25-30 minutes as boneless pieces tend to cook faster. Ensure they reach an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) for safety.

What other herbs can I use if I don't have lemon herb seasoning?

If you don’t have lemon herb seasoning, you can create your own mix using dried basil, thyme, oregano, and some lemon zest. This blend will provide a similar flavor profile and enhance the dish's overall taste.

Can I grill this chicken instead of baking it?

Absolutely! Grilling is a fantastic alternative. Marinate the chicken as directed and then grill over medium heat for about 6-8 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C). This method adds a nice smoky flavor.
